Kimberly-Clark Corporation (KMB) - Cash Flow Conversion Efficiency
Based on the latest financial reports, Kimberly-Clark Corporation (KMB) has a cash flow conversion efficiency ratio of 0.588x as of December 2025. Cash flow conversion efficiency measures how effectively a company's net assets (equity) generate operating cash flow. It is calculated by dividing operating cash flow ($972.00 Million) by net assets ($1.65 Billion). A higher ratio indicates that the company is more efficient at using its equity to generate cash flow from its core operations. Annual Cash Flow Conversion Efficiency for Kimberly-Clark Corporation (1989–2025)
The table below shows the annual cash flow conversion efficiency of Kimberly-Clark Corporation from 1989 to 2025. For the full company profile with market capitalisation and key ratios, see KMB stock market capitalisation.
| Year | Net Assets | Operating Cash Flow | Cash Flow Conversion Efficiency | Change |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2025-12-31 | $1.65 Billion | $2.78 Billion | 1.681x | -49.32% |
| 2024-12-31 | $975.00 Million | $3.23 Billion | 3.317x | +0.01% |
| 2023-12-31 | $1.07 Billion | $3.54 Billion | 3.316x | -15.06% |
| 2022-12-31 | $700.00 Million | $2.73 Billion | 3.904x | +5.40% |
| 2021-12-31 | $737.00 Million | $2.73 Billion | 3.704x | -13.68% |
| 2020-12-31 | $869.00 Million | $3.73 Billion | 4.291x | -69.57% |
| 2019-12-31 | $194.00 Million | $2.74 Billion | 14.103x | +121.84% |
| 2018-12-31 | $-46.00 Million | $2.97 Billion | -64.565x | -2044.23% |
| 2017-12-31 | $882.00 Million | $2.93 Billion | 3.321x | -87.98% |
| 2016-12-31 | $117.00 Million | $3.23 Billion | 27.624x | -52.08% |
| 2015-12-31 | $40.00 Million | $2.31 Billion | 57.650x | +1924.34% |
| 2014-12-31 | $999.00 Million | $2.85 Billion | 2.848x | +381.51% |
| 2013-12-31 | $5.14 Billion | $3.04 Billion | 0.591x | -4.90% |
| 2012-12-31 | $5.29 Billion | $3.29 Billion | 0.622x | +50.28% |
| 2011-12-31 | $5.53 Billion | $2.29 Billion | 0.414x | -6.47% |
| 2010-12-31 | $6.20 Billion | $2.74 Billion | 0.442x | -27.68% |
| 2009-12-31 | $5.69 Billion | $3.48 Billion | 0.612x | +4.12% |
| 2008-12-31 | $4.28 Billion | $2.52 Billion | 0.588x | +38.08% |
| 2007-12-31 | $5.71 Billion | $2.43 Billion | 0.426x | +7.56% |
| 2006-12-31 | $6.52 Billion | $2.58 Billion | 0.396x | +1.87% |
| 2005-12-31 | $5.95 Billion | $2.31 Billion | 0.388x | -8.48% |
| 2004-12-31 | $7.00 Billion | $2.97 Billion | 0.424x | +14.73% |
| 2003-12-31 | $7.06 Billion | $2.61 Billion | 0.370x | -10.71% |
| 2002-12-31 | $5.85 Billion | $2.42 Billion | 0.414x | +9.48% |
| 2001-12-31 | $5.96 Billion | $2.25 Billion | 0.378x | +7.29% |
| 2000-12-31 | $6.05 Billion | $2.13 Billion | 0.353x | -11.80% |
| 1999-12-31 | $5.34 Billion | $2.13 Billion | 0.400x | -18.55% |
| 1998-12-31 | $4.06 Billion | $1.99 Billion | 0.491x | +49.64% |
| 1997-12-31 | $4.29 Billion | $1.41 Billion | 0.328x | -7.29% |
| 1996-12-31 | $4.73 Billion | $1.67 Billion | 0.354x | +47.62% |
| 1995-12-31 | $3.89 Billion | $931.60 Million | 0.240x | -4.13% |
| 1994-12-31 | $2.68 Billion | $669.00 Million | 0.250x | -15.49% |
| 1993-12-31 | $2.52 Billion | $746.70 Million | 0.296x | -18.36% |
| 1992-12-31 | $2.25 Billion | $814.50 Million | 0.362x | +26.35% |
| 1991-12-31 | $2.57 Billion | $737.10 Million | 0.287x | -10.29% |
| 1990-12-31 | $2.30 Billion | $736.80 Million | 0.320x | -8.14% |
| 1989-12-31 | $2.19 Billion | $762.60 Million | 0.348x | -- |
